A gap between the sash's frame and the frame could be the reason behind your windows not closing properly. This could cause draughts, however it could also cause dampness and water damage. You can check by putting a piece paper between the frame and the sash, to see whether the sash is closed.

To fix this, you will need to remove the seal around the frame and sash. Then, you'll have to remove the gearbox that locks from its position within the frame. This requires the aid of a tool, such as a flat screwdriver and a torch to get the gearbox. Once you have removed the gearbox, you'll need to replace it with a new one with the same type and size.

Another problem that is frequently encountered is the presence of water condensation between the glass panes of your double-glazed UPVC windows. This is usually the result of window frames aren't fitted correctly or if the nail fins have become loose and not able to provide a reliable seal. A specialist in uPVC repair will replace the seals and ensure that the window is well sealed, preventing drafts and increasing energy efficiency.
